Here’s the math: The average new ATM costs between $2,300 and $3,000. Source: Lieberman Companies. As we just discussed, the average gross revenue can be $540 per month, which equals $6,480 per year. WebA freestanding ATM machine with a full-color display, 1,000 note cassettes, and dial-up internet connection is priced between $2,800 to $4,590. ATM machine mounted in a wall with 2,000 note cassettes and wireless Internet connection costs around $6,800 to $9,060. The overall cost to purchase ATM machines averages between $2,100 to $4,330. facility transfer meaning

Web24 jan. 2024 · Customers nationwide report paying an average of $2,000 to $4,000 for an ATM machine. Additional ATM costs might include: A phone line ( $20 to $40/month) Cash loading service (optional; roughly $40 to $60 per trip) An additional cash cassette (approximately $100 to $500) Replacement receipt paper WebThe term ATM stands for automated teller machine.
